Amid mounting online pressure, Nigerian singer Chike has broken his silence regarding allegations linking him to the collapsed marriage of media personality Frank Edoho and his ex-wife, Sandra Onyenucheya.

Responding to the growing backlash, the singer pleaded with fans and critics to “have mercy” on his soul.

The singer has recently found himself at the centre of intense conversations across social media platforms, where users repeatedly accused him of allegedly being involved in the breakdown of the former couple’s marriage.

The controversy reignited after old claims and social media discussions resurfaced online, drawing fresh attention to the singer’s personal life.

Although Chike did not directly confirm or deny the allegations, he appeared emotionally drained by the constant attacks and scrutiny.

In a short message dropped on his social media platform obtained by Persecondnews, the singer said:” Pity My Soul”, in what is believed to be his subtle way of appealing to fans and critics who have continued to drag him on the matter.

The music star urged people to stop dragging him endlessly over issues he has consistently avoided speaking about publicly.

His emotional reaction immediately triggered mixed responses online.

While some fans sympathized with the singer and argued that the public had become too harsh in judging celebrities without concrete facts, others insisted that public curiosity around the matter would continue because of the longstanding rumours surrounding him and Sandra.

The controversy has lingered for years within entertainment circles, especially after speculation emerged shortly after Frank Edoho’s separation from his former wife became public knowledge.

Social media users frequently linked Chike’s name to Sandra, leading to persistent online conversations that have refused to fade away completely.

Persecondnews recalls that Edoho, the one-time iconic host of Nigeria’s Who Wants To Be A Millionaire?, has previously spoken about his failed marriage but has never publicly pointed fingers at anyone for the split.
